Alert me about new properties
MARKET PRICE
Market value:
£2,219
MARKET PRICE
Market value:
£793
MARKET PRICE
Market value:
£765
MARKET PRICE
Market value:
£2,219
MARKET PRICE
Market value:
£2,219
MARKET PRICE
Market value:
£775
MARKET PRICE
Market value:
£2,219